Tibet-themed art exhibition opens in Nanxiang

June 24,2016 -- An art exhibition on Tibet-themed calligraphy, painting and photography was launched in the Nanxiang Cultural and Sports Center on June 20, in celebration of the 95th anniversary of the founding of the CPC, local media reported.
 
Over 100 works, created by those who have dedicated their lives to the construction and development of Tibet, were on display.
 
The exhibition, held several days before the Party's birthday, which falls on July 1 every year, also marks the 80th anniversary of the victory of the Long March and the 20th anniversary of Shanghai's aid to Tibet.
 
The art show is the first of its kind sponsored by the Shanghai Aiding Tibet Association since its inception 20 years ago.
 
The association says it plans to set up a Shanghai-Tibet culture salon since it has many members with drawing, calligraphy and photography abilities.
 
The salon is expected to function as a platform for members to exchange skills and show off their talents.
